My Buying Guides on Pink Toilet Bowl Cleaner
When I started looking for a pink toilet bowl cleaner, I realized there were more differences than I expected. Some products focus on stain removal, others on freshness, and some are better for regular maintenance than deep cleaning. Here is what I look for when choosing the right one.
1. Cleaning Power
The first thing I check is whether the cleaner can handle stains, limescale, and buildup. I want a product that does more than just make the bowl look clean. If I have hard water stains or stubborn marks, I prefer a formula that clings to the bowl and works fast.
2. Scent and Freshness
Since I use toilet bowl cleaner regularly, the scent matters a lot to me. I usually choose a pink cleaner with a fresh, pleasant fragrance that is not too strong. A clean smell makes the bathroom feel fresher, but I avoid anything overpowering.
3. Safe Ingredients
I always look at the ingredients before buying. If I can find a cleaner that is effective but still gentle on plumbing and septic systems, that is a big plus for me. I also prefer products that are less harsh on surfaces and safer to use around my home.
4. Bottle Design and Ease of Use
I like a bottle that is easy to grip and has a nozzle that helps me apply the cleaner under the rim. This makes cleaning quicker and less messy. A well-designed bottle can make a big difference in how often I actually use the product.
5. Foaming or Thick Formula
From my experience, thicker formulas tend to stay in place better. I usually like a gel or foaming cleaner because it clings to the bowl longer and gives the product more time to work. Thin liquids often run off too quickly for my liking.
6. Value for Money
I compare the price with the number of uses I get from the bottle. Sometimes a slightly more expensive cleaner is worth it if it works better and lasts longer. I try to balance cost with performance instead of choosing only the cheapest option.
7. Brand Reputation
I feel more confident buying from brands that have good reviews and a strong reputation. If other users say the cleaner works well and is reliable, I am more likely to try it. Customer feedback helps me avoid products that look good but do not perform well.
8. Scented vs. Unscented Preference
Some pink toilet bowl cleaners are heavily scented, while others are milder. I choose based on how I use the product. If I want a stronger freshening effect, I go with scented. If I am sensitive to fragrance, I look for a lighter option.
